#de144d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de144d is composed of 87.1% red, 7.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 343.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 47.5%. #de144d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ff289a with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#de144d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de144d has RGB values of R:222, G:20,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.65,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14554189.

Shades and Tints of #de144d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060102 is the darkest color, while #fef3f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#de144d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817176 is the less saturated color, while #f10145 is the most saturated one.
